4 or 6? This was a blazing topic in my leagues for several years. About half steadfastly insisted on 4 and the other half were passionate for 6. We tried both ways, although the year with 6 was the year both Manning and Culpepper had like a zillion TDs each and that sent those who preferred 4 over the deep edge.

 

Here is how the commish (me) resolved the issue. For the past 3 - 4 years we have compromised on 5 pts for Passing TDs. Not a complaint in the house. Lame? Maybe. But as Commish, I prefer quiet. :wacko: Just call me King Solomon

I have a scoring setup where QB's get between 6-9 points for a TD depending on the distance and the top 10 is packed with RB's mixed in with some QB's....

 

I believe it is the ultimate scoring system because whenever a QB runs or catches for a TD...it's 9-12 pts based on the distance as well...

 

same goes for a RB except it only focuses more points for when you perform out of your "position"...

 

everyone focuses on who is all in the top 10, but if every QB gets the same for a TD, then it is what it is...don't ya think?.....I think too much has been made about the QB's getting so many points that we forget.......every team has a QB...

 

maybe this would change how we draft?....but I always wait until the 5th round or so to take a QB and it all still comes out in the wash.....it's all about the dropoffs at each position...

 

I approach the draft of a league where passing TD's are 4 pts the same way I approach the draft in my league with it's high performance based scoring....

 

if a QB is scoring that many more points than other positions.....my response is "so what?"...you have kickers and Defense's scoring much less than other positions.....why not boost their scoring if you are really focused on balancing the top 10.....the top 10 means nothing to me other than knowing who is performing well at their position and a top 10 I would rather look at than "overall" is by each position...
